Attendees: T. Greaves, L. Mbatha, R. Voss.

Reviewed draft franchise agreement with Copperline Eats for the Dunmere territory. Royalty rate agreed at 5.5%; marketing levy deferred to year two. Legal to tighten the territory exclusivity clause by Friday. Fit-out costs to be borne by franchisee; we cover initial training only. Greaves to confirm indemnity limits with insurers. Target signing within three weeks. Finance to model cash impact under both ramp scenarios. One confidential item was raised and is recorded below.

board note of tawig-bajof: The renewal with Ralixix Holdings closes at $10 million a year, 20 percent above the last contract. Project Druix slips by two quarters because of the tooling delay.

Quarterly Planning Note — Divestiture of the Coastal Tooling Unit

For the finance team: the sale of the Coastal Tooling unit to Pellmark Industries remains on track for close in Q3. Please finalize the carve-out balance sheet, reconcile intercompany positions, and prepare the working-capital adjustment schedule by month-end. Audit support requests should be prioritized. For planning purposes, note the following sensitive item:

internal memo for hawef-kahif: The finance team signed off on a budget of $25.9 million for Project Sorox. The renewal with Pelokek Logistics closes at $51.7 million a year, 52 percent below the last contract.

// Crash-report pipeline constant for the Wrenfall mobile app.
// Support: crash reports land in the Ostrel intake queue within
// ~90 seconds of app restart. This constant caps retained reports
// per device per day; anything above it is dropped client-side,
// so missing reports from chatty devices are expected, not a bug.
// Do not raise without checking Ostrel storage quotas first.
// Symbolication runs in a separate Ostrel worker; delays there
// don't affect intake. Pipeline build is identified by the token below.

session token of tajef-bageg = htk21_5d90d574934f3ccae6437

- [ ] Run the Shadeproof contrast audit against all bundled and third-party themes before tagging the release. Plugin authors: your palette files must pass the minimum ratio checks or the audit gate will block packaging. Attach the audit report to the release notes and confirm no overrides were applied. Record the audit build token on the line below.

pipeline stamp: htk9_ce63042d9